What does this PR do?
Original issue: huggingface/peft#2256
There is a potential error when using load_best_model_at_end=True with a prompt learning PEFT method. This is because Trainer uses
load_adapterunder the hood but with some prompt learning methods, there is an optimization on the saved model to remove parameters that are not required for inference, which in turn requires a change to the model architecture. This is whyload_adapterwill fail in such cases and users should instead setload_best_model_at_end=Falseand usePeftModel.from_pretrained. As this is not obvious, we now intercept the error and add a helpful error message.Before submitting
